The City is in receipt of a Site Plan Review Application [SPR 20-26] & Special Exemption Permit [SEP 21- 04] from the applicant, Russ & Barr, Inc., Russ Dibartolomeo. A Preliminary Site Plan review for the proposed uses at the subject site 761 W. Huron. The submitted Site Plan Review proposes to renovate the existing structure to operate mixed-use retail and office spaces, and mini storage rental units located in the southern portion of the property.

Preliminary Site Plan The subject property,is a developed and derelict property, and a former bank facility. The property is presently designated the C-1 Local Business zoning district, the proposed retail and office uses are permitted by-right within the C-1 Local Business District. The proposed Mini-Storage use is not permitted within the C-1 Local Business District, to operate a Mini-Storage use a C-3 Corridor Commercial District zoning designation is required. Furthermore, the Mini-Storage use in the C-3 Corridor Commercial requires a Special Exemption Permit and Public Hearing by the City of Pontiac Planning Commission.

The Planning Division has conducted a Preliminary Technical review and recommends a Two-Step Site Plan Process, in accordance with the City of Pontiac Zoning Ordinance. This process entails a preliminary Site Plan Review and simultaneous Special Exemption Permit Review to be conducted and approved by the Planning Division.

Preliminary Site Plans expire one year after the date of the preliminary approval, unless the final site plan for the project has been submitted to the Planning Department for review prior to the expiration date.

Final Site Plan Review would be conditional and granted pending compliance with all Site Plan Review criteria identified below, the City of Pontiac Zoning Ordinance, and approval of the required Zoning Map Amendment, changing the subject property zoning designation from C-1 Local Business district to C-3 Corridor Commercial District. Special Exemption Permit Review

The applicant has made petition for a Special Exemption Permit to permit a Mini-Storage use at the subject property. The subject site is currently zoned C-1 Local Business, which does not permit the Mini-Storage use by-right, or by Special Exemption Permit. Final approval and issuance of a Special Exemption for a Mini-Storage use is conditioned to, and requires a Zoning Map Amendment, from the current C-1 zoning designation to C-3 Corridor Commercial, in addition to compliance with the below Zoning Ordinance Criteria for Mini-Warehouse uses, Section 2.519.

A. Fencing. The perimeter of the storage area shall be fenced. The fence shall have a minimum height of eight feet, and decorative fencing shall be used in the front yard. An entrance gate shall be provided with a minimum access width of 12 feet, with either electronic or manual control. B. Buildings. 1. In the C-3 District. All storage units shall be located in one building. The building may not use metal or cinder block as its primary building material and shall be designed consistent with other commercial buildings in the vicinity of the site. C. Indoor Storage Only. All items shall be stored inside an enclosed facility

Special Exemption Permit Review Requirements

When considering any petition for Special Exemption Permit, the Pontiac Planning Commission must consider the criteria of Section 6.303 of the City Zoning Ordinance, which states:

The Planning Commission shall review each application for the purpose of determining that each use on its proposed location will:

1. Be harmonious with and in accordance with the general principles and objectives of the comprehensive master plan of the City of Pontiac. [Meets]

2. Be designed, constructed, operated and maintained so as to be harmonious and appropriate in appearance with the existing or intended character of the general vicinity by way of size, character, or location. [Meets]

3. Not change the essential character of the area in which it is proposed, and not adversely affect the development or redevelopment of the surrounding neighborhood. [Meets]

4. Not be hazardous or disturbing to existing or future uses in the same general vicinity and will be a substantial improvement to property in the immediate vicinity and to the community as a whole. [Meets]

5. Be served adequately by essential public facilities and services, such as highways, streets, police, fire protection, drainage structures, refuse disposal water and sewage facilities and schools. [Meets]

6. Not involve uses, activities, processes, materials, and equipment or conditions of operation that will be detrimental to any person, property or general welfare as a result of producing excess traffic, noise, smoke,Jumes, glare, or odors out of proportion to that normally prevailing in the particular district. [Meets]

The City of Pontiac is in receipt of application ZMA 21-04 for a Zoning Map Amendment [rezoning] per Section 6.802 of the Zoning Ordinance for parcel Number 64-17-33-407-035, -036, -037. The subject site is located at the intersection of Midway Ave. and S. Sanford St. The subject property is currently zoned R-1 Single Family Dwelling, the applicant requests a rezoning from R-1 to C-1 Local Business, and proposes neighborhood grocer and the current abandoned building.

Master Plan According to the City's 2014 Master Plan Update any new economic prospects on which to build a sustainable destiny with new commercial and industrial development is a major land use objective. It is with this spirit that is embedded in the Master Plan update.

The subject site is planned as Traditional Neighborhood Residential. These areas allow a range of building styles and uses with the Local Business & Commercial uses clustered on major uses. This designation includes most of the City's traditionally single-family neighborhoods

Existing Zoning Districts Properties to the north, east, south and west are zoned R-1 One Family Dwelling District. The current residential zoning make-up of the area is consistent with the City of Pontiac Master Plans and the Future Land Use Plan.

1 Rezoning Criteria The Pontiac Planning Commission must consider any of the following criteria [section 6.804, A-J] that apply to the rezoning application in making findings, recommendations, and a decision to amend the Official Zoning Map [Section 6.804]. Additionally, the section also stipulates that the Pontiac Planning Commission may also consider other factors that are applicable to the application, but are not listed among the ten criteria. To assist in the evaluation of these and other criteria, we offer the following findings of fact for your consideration. The ten stated criteria are listed below with our findings:

1. Consistency with the goals, policies and objectives of the Master Plan and any sub-area plans. If conditions have changed since the Master Plan was adopted, consistency with recent development trends in the area shall be considered. [Meets]

2. Compatibility of the site's physical, geological, hydrological and other environmental features with the uses permitted in the proposed zoning district. [Meets]

3. Evidence the applicant cannot receive a reasonable return on investment through developing the property with one (1) or more of the uses permitted under the current zoning. [Meets]

4. Compatibility of all the potential uses allowed in the proposed zoning district with surrounding uses and zoning in terms of land suitability, impacts on the environment, density, nature of use, traffic impacts, aesthetics, infrastructure and potential influence on property values. [Meets]

5. The capacity of the City's utilities and services sufficient to accommodate the uses permitted in the requested district without compromising the health, safety and welfare of the City. [Meets]

6. The capability of the street system to safely and efficiently accommodate the expected traffic generated by uses permitted in the requested zoning district. [Meets]

7. The boundaries of the requested rezoning district are reasonable in relationship to surroundings and construction on the site will be able to meet the dimensional regulations for the requested zoning district. [Meets]

8. If a rezoning is appropriate, the requested zoning district is considered to be more appropriate from the City's perspective than another zoning district. [Meets]

9. If the request is for a specific use, rezoning the land is considered to be more appropriate than amending the list of permitted or special land uses in the current zoning district to allow the use. [Meets]

10. The requested rezoning will not create an isolated or incompatible zone in the Neighborhood. [Meets]

Recommendation We suggest that the Planning Commission consider to approval the Zoning Map Amendment [ZMA 21-04] request for 327 Midway Ave, also known as Parcel No. 64-17-33-407-035, -036, - 037 to amend the current site zoning from R-1 One Family Dwelling to C-1 Local Business.

The City is in receipt of a Site Plan Review Application [SPR 21-13] from the applicant, Chad Asman, on

behalf of RLA Studio. The submitted Site Plan dated 5/25/21, located at 616 W. Huron, proposes to

construct a new commercial building, and to establish a commercial office for the benefit of business

operations related to Hope Against Trafficking.

Existing Site Conditions The subject property, 616 W. Huron, was formerly a multi-family structure, which maintained three

residential units. The structure was determined to be Noticed and Condemned on October 31, 2008. On

July 16, 2014, the Board of Appeals resolved for the structure to be demolished. On January 22, 2021

the property owner made application to the Department of Building & Safety for Demolition Permit

[PD210002]. The aforementioned property is zoned C-1 Local Business, and is currently a vacant parcel.

Proposed Use The applicant has proposed to construct a new commercial office building on the subject property, at

the intersection of Murphy St, and the W. Huron Corridor. The Office Use is permitted by right in

accordance with the City of Pontiac Zoning Ordinance. New Construction developments require Site Plan

review approval from the Planning Commission, following a completed technical review conducted by

the Planning Division.

Technical Site Plan Review The Planning Division has conducted a Technical Review and recommends a Site Plan Review approval

with the Planning Commission, the Technical Review criteria and comments are provided below. Site

Plan Review [SPR 21-13] is granted a Preliminary Site Plan Review Approval on July 12, 2021. Final Site

Plan Approval will be granted from the Planning Commission following Plan Review approval from The

Abdul H. Siddiqui, P.E., City Engineer Department of Public Works CITY OF PONTIAC 47450 Woodward Avenue Pontiac, Michigan 48342

Project Name: 841 Auburn Avenue Review Phase: Preliminary Site Plan Engineering Review

City of Pontiac Planning Case: SPR 20-23 Zoning: C-3 Manufacturing and Processing {Light)

Parcel: Lots 66 and 67 and part of lots 65, 68 and 69 of "Homestead Park 1" City of Pontiac, Oakland County, Michigan

Drawings Reviewed: Urban Land Consultants Plans Dated 02/01/2021

Review Action: Plans Acceptable for Preliminary Engineering Purposes

Dear Mr. Siddiqui,

In accordance with your request, our office has reviewed the Preliminary Site Plan Engineering for the above referenced project as submitted by La Rocca Construction {ULC Plans Dated 02/01/2021), The plans have been reviewed for conformance with City Ordinance Site Plan requirements. Our comments at this time are limited to general observations with regard to the proposed storm water management system, a preliminary floodplain review, and proposed water and sanitary sewer lead extensions. A more detailed review will be provided at the time of engineering plan submittal in accordance with the City of Pontiac ordinances and requirements. Our comments related to this review are as follows:

STORM WATER

1. The project Engineer has provided preliminary detention calculations on Sheet 2 of 3 of the Site Clvil Engineer Plan for a 10-year storm event for sizing the proposed storage system. This system is designed to discharge into an existing storm drain located in Auburn Avenue R.O.W. In accordance with City ordinance requirements, the Applicant shall be solely responsible to determine the feasibility of the proposed discharge point and downstream conditions from the stormwater outlet. The emergency overflow route for the drainage areas and calculations showing proper restrictor size and emergency overflow capacity wlll need to be included in the Engineering submittal once Site Plan approval is granted. 2. The final storm water management system shall be designed to meet all City Engineering Design Standards

FEMA DESIGNATED SFHA

1, According to FEMA FIRM Map Number 2612SC0369F, Effective September 29, 2006 this site is located outside the designated Special Flood Hazard Area (see attached FEMA FIRMette)

NOWAK & FRAUS ENGINEERS 46777 WOODWARD WW\V.NOWAKFRAUS.COM VOICE: 248.332.7931 AVENUE FAX: 248.332.8257 PONTIAC, MI 48342-5032 CIVIL ENGINEERS LAND SURVEYORS

841 Auburn Avenue April 6, 2021 Page 2 of 2

WATER AND SEWER SERVICE CONNECTION

1. The Project Engineer is proposing to Install a new publlc waterline for a new hydrant and utilize existing service leads for the new building. These Items are under the jurisdiction of the Oakland County Water Resource Commission {OCWRC) and can be addressed at the time of Engineering Plan submittal once Site Plan approval is granted. NFE only recommends that the Engineer reach out to OCWRC now to determine the feasibility of using these existing service leads prior to final Engineering Plan submittals or If new taps will be required.

Based on our review and the above review comments, we find the plans acceptable for preliminary engineering purposes. If the Site Plan ls recommended for approval by the Planning Commission, Engineering Plans shall be submitted to the City of Pontiac for a more detailed review.
